ماژول RC522 یکی از محبوبترین ماژولهای RFID برای پروژههای الکترونیکی است. این ماژول به شما امکان میدهد که از طریق فناوری RFID (شناسایی با فرکانس رادیویی)، دادهها را از کارتها یا تگهای RFID بخوانید. این ابزار کوچک و مقرونبهصرفه به راحتی میتواند با پلتفرمهایی مانند آردوینو یا رزبری پای ادغام شود، و این امکان را به پروژههای شما میدهد تا بر اساس کارتهای RFID عمل کنند. از کنترل دربها گرفته تا پروژههای هوشمندسازی، ماژول RC522 کاربردهای متنوعی دارد که در ادامه به آنها خواهیم پرداخت.
ماژول RC522 RFID چیست؟
ماژول RC522 یک ماژول بسیار رایج برای خواندن و نوشتن روی تگهای RFID با فرکانس 13.56 مگاهرتز است. این ماژول دارای یک رابط SPI برای ارتباط سریع با میکروکنترلرها و دیگر بردهای الکترونیکی است. بسیاری از علاقهمندان به الکترونیک از این ماژول به دلیل هزینه پایین و سهولت استفادهاش در پروژههای مختلف استفاده میکنند.
ویژگیهای کلیدی ماژول RC522
- پشتیبانی از فرکانس 13.56 مگاهرتز
- ارتباط از طریق رابط SPI
- قابلیت خواندن و نوشتن بر روی تگهای RFID
- فاصله تشخیص تا 5 سانتیمتر
- مصرف توان کم و مناسب برای پروژههای قابل حمل
پروژههای ممکن با استفاده از ماژول RC522
ماژول RC522 به دلیل سازگاری و قابلیتهای متنوعش در پروژههای متعددی استفاده میشود. در ادامه به چندین نمونه از پروژههای محبوب اشاره خواهیم کرد که با استفاده از این ماژول میتوان آنها را پیادهسازی کرد.
سیستم ورود و خروج هوشمند
یکی از رایجترین کاربردهای ماژول RC522، ساخت سیستمهای ورود و خروج هوشمند است. این سیستمها با استفاده از کارتهای RFID، دسترسی افراد به مکانهای خاص را مدیریت میکنند. برای پیادهسازی این پروژه، نیاز به موارد زیر دارید:
- ماژول RC522
- آردوینو یا میکروکنترلر مشابه
- رله برای کنترل قفل درب
- منبع تغذیه مناسب
در این پروژه، وقتی کارت RFID نزدیک ماژول قرار میگیرد، سیستم اطلاعات کارت را میخواند و در صورتی که کارت معتبر باشد، قفل باز میشود.
سیستم شناسایی اتوماتیک کالاها
یکی دیگر از پروژههای کاربردی با ماژول RC522، سیستم شناسایی اتوماتیک کالاها است. این پروژه معمولاً در انبارها و فروشگاهها برای مدیریت موجودی کالاها استفاده میشود. با اضافه کردن یک صفحه نمایش کوچک و اتصال به بانک دادهها، میتوانید به سرعت وضعیت موجودی کالاها را بررسی کنید.
وسایلی که برای این پروژه نیاز دارید شامل:
- ماژول RC522
- نمایشگر LCD یا OLED
- آردوینو یا برد مشابه
- کارتها یا تگهای RFID متصل به کالاها
قفل هوشمند مبتنی بر RFID
پروژه قفل هوشمند یکی دیگر از کاربردهای جالب RC522 است که به راحتی میتوانید با این ماژول بسازید. این پروژه شامل موارد زیر است:
- ماژول RC522
- سرو موتور برای قفل مکانیکی
- آردوینو
- دکمه برای ریست یا تغییر کارتهای معتبر
کاربران میتوانند با استفاده از کارت RFID خود درب را باز یا بسته کنند، و سرو موتور قفل را به صورت خودکار مدیریت میکند.
لوازم جانبی و ابزارهای ضروری برای استفاده با ماژول RC522
برای راهاندازی موفقیتآمیز پروژههای مبتنی بر RC522، علاوه بر این ماژول، به برخی لوازم جانبی و ابزارهای دیگر نیاز خواهید داشت که در زیر به آنها اشاره میکنیم:
آردوینو یا میکروکنترلرها
برای کنترل ماژول RC522، معمولاً از یک میکروکنترلر مانند آردوینو استفاده میشود. بردهای مختلف آردوینو مانند UNO، Nano و Mega به راحتی میتوانند با این ماژول ارتباط برقرار کنند و پروژههای مختلف را به اجرا درآورند.
کابلهای جامپر و بردبورد
برای اتصال ماژول RC522 به میکروکنترلر و سایر اجزا، به کابلهای جامپر و بردبورد نیاز دارید. این ابزارها امکان اتصال سریع و ساده را فراهم میکنند و نیازی به لحیمکاری ندارید.
رله و منابع تغذیه
در پروژههایی که نیاز به کنترل رله یا دیگر ابزارهای برقی مانند قفل درب دارید، به رلههای مناسب و یک منبع تغذیه قوی و پایدار نیاز خواهید داشت. معمولاً منابع تغذیه 5 ولتی برای پروژههای مبتنی بر آردوینو مناسب هستند.
صفحهنمایش
در برخی پروژهها مانند سیستم شناسایی کالاها یا سیستمهای ورود و خروج، اضافه کردن یک صفحه نمایش میتواند اطلاعات مفیدی را به کاربران ارائه دهد. نمایشگرهای OLED یا LCD گزینههای محبوب برای این منظور هستند.
مزایای استفاده از ماژول RC522
استفاده از ماژول RC522 در پروژههای RFID دارای مزایای بسیاری است که باعث محبوبیت آن در بین مهندسین و علاقهمندان به الکترونیک شده است.
- هزینه پایین: ماژول RC522 نسبت به سایر راهحلهای RFID بسیار مقرونبهصرفه است.
- سادگی در استفاده: با استفاده از کتابخانههای آماده برای آردوینو، پیادهسازی پروژههای مبتنی بر RC522 بسیار ساده است.
- اندازه کوچک: اندازه کوچک این ماژول باعث میشود که در پروژههای قابل حمل و کوچک بسیار مفید باشد.
- توانایی خواندن و نوشتن: قابلیت خواندن و نوشتن دادهها روی تگهای RFID یکی از ویژگیهای مهم این ماژول است که به پروژههای تعاملی اضافه میکند.
سوالات متداول
آیا ماژول RC522 نیاز به تنظیمات خاصی دارد؟
خیر، ماژول RC522 با استفاده از کتابخانههای آماده مانند “MFRC522” در آردوینو به راحتی قابل استفاده است و نیاز به تنظیمات پیچیدهای ندارد.
فاصله کارکرد ماژول RC522 چقدر است؟
فاصله کارکرد این ماژول برای خواندن کارتهای RFID معمولاً تا 5 سانتیمتر است، اما این فاصله به نوع کارت و شرایط محیطی بستگی دارد.
آیا ماژول RC522 با تمامی کارتهای RFID سازگار است؟
این ماژول با کارتها و تگهای RFID که در فرکانس 13.56 مگاهرتز کار میکنند، سازگار است.
چگونه میتوان امنیت پروژههای مبتنی بر RC522 را افزایش داد؟
با استفاده از الگوریتمهای رمزنگاری یا اعتبارسنجی کارتهای RFID میتوانید امنیت پروژههای خود را افزایش دهید.
آیا میتوان با استفاده از ماژول RC522 دادهها را روی تگهای RFID نوشت؟
بله، ماژول RC522 قابلیت نوشتن دادهها روی تگهای RFID را دارد، اما توجه کنید که برخی از تگها ممکن است فقط خواندنی باشند.
آیا این ماژول نیاز به منبع تغذیه خاصی دارد؟
ماژول RC522 معمولاً با ولتاژ 3.3 ولت کار میکند، اما میتوان آن را با بردهای آردوینو که از 5 ولت استفاده میکنند، سازگار کرد.